Objective: To validate the I-BATARA learning model. The I-BATARA learning model, designed by integrating local cultural contexts, batik Tanjung Bumi, and scientific concepts, aims to improve science literacy. Method: Educational development research was used as the research design. Validation of the I-BATARA leaning model and instructional package involves two criteria: content validation and construct validation. Three experts in pedagogy, science content, and learning assessment validated the I-BATARA learning model and instructional package. Results: The research findings and data analysis indicated that the I-BATARA learning model has consistently yielded relevant outcomes. The I-BATARA model has met strict validity and reliability standards (with an agreement percentage >75%). Novelty: Validated learning support components include lesson plans, student textbooks, student worksheets, and scientific literacy tests. The I-BATARA learning model can be applied to foster students' scientific literacy through local cultural contexts. The model is suitable for meaningful science learning and for developing students' social skills, while offering practical implications for SDG 4 (Quality Education) by promoting culturally relevant, context-based scientific literacy instruction.
